Uwatec has produced a great all-around performer in the Smart TEC. I would say it is not a real TEC computer but it will allow for multiple tanks. Nice display with an easy to use menu setup. Holds 99 dives and is syncable with a PC not a MAC. Very accurate Depth Reading. Accent meter is almost to sensative with no way to adjust. This means if you are accending and raising your arm your computer will deep. You can also adjust how conservative the nitrogen absorption algorithm is with the microbubble settings L1-L5. I found the Suunto's algorithm way too conservative and the oceaenic too liberal. The Uwatec is great at L0 setting and you can go to five more conservative settings if you want. Overall a great computer. No regrets

Have had nothing but problems with this device - battery only lasted 7 months (did about 12 dives with it). It is suppose to allow up to 3 transmitters on 3 separate tanks - it would only pair with one transmitter (I was told it was a software problem). Any Maintenance requires it to be returned to dealer - even batteries.I have owned other Uwatec/ScubaPro items and all have been excellent. This is the first that I would not recommend for use on any kind of dive.

I upgraded from the air Z Nitro to the Smart Tec. Both are great dive computers, however the Transmitter Flex hose available from Uwatec should not be used. On shore dives on the president in Vanuatu the computer froze twice swimming out to the descent point, when I removed the Flex hose it operated flawlessly. I concluded as I was swimming out to the descent point the waves caused to hose to flex thereby varying the pressure to the transmitter and "confusing" the computer. So screw it directly into the first stage is the way to go!!

I have owned this unit for a little less than a year, and have logged well over 100 OW dives on it. It is a great little computer and has helped extend my learning curve tremendously in terms of gas management. I always dive a redundant set-up, and this computer teams up well with the UWaTec Bottom Timer. I haven't experienced any sort of pairing issues, nor have I had any sort of excessive battery drains: the meter is currently at 75%...Can't wait to upgrade to the Galileo
